Method and system for evaluating and predicting sprocket tooth wear
An exemplary method may comprise: ascertaining an original distance between a first tooth face and a second tooth face of a sprocket tooth, wherein the sprocket tooth comprises two tooth faces extending from a sprocket core and terminating in a top of the sprocket tooth, wherein an original distance separates the two tooth faces, placing a sprocket gauge on the sprocket tooth, wherein the sprocket gauge comprises: a bottom, and two gauge faces extending from the bottom of the sprocket gauge, wherein the bottom of the sprocket gauge is disposed upon the top of the sprocket tooth and the first gauge face is disposed adjacently on the first tooth; and comparing the original distance defined by the sprocket gauge with an actual distance between the first tooth face and the second tooth face.

ELECTRONIC CALIPER FOR ASSESSING PATIENT BIOMECHANICS
A system for displaying and collecting biomechanical measurements is provided. The system comprises: an electronic caliper including a bar, two arms slidably mounted on the bar and extending normal therefrom, a display module, and an electronic system housed in the display module and comprising a light emitting diode string of lights, a nine-axis sensor, firmware, a wireless radio, and a power source connector for electronic communication with a power source; and a remote computing device, the wireless radio in communication with the remote computing device. The electronic caliper and method of use thereof is also provided.

Scale identifier
Scale identifier systems and methods for generating a log of scale type and location in subterranean formations, and, more particularly, in wellbore tubing are provided. A method for scale identification may be provided. The method may comprise providing a first logging tool comprising a tool body, a neutron source coupled to the tool body, and detectors coupled to the tool body; providing a second logging tool for measuring deviations in inner diameter of a tubing in a wellbore; placing the first logging tool and the second logging tool into the wellbore; logging the interior of the tubing with the first logging tool and the second logging tool to generate data; and generating a log of scale location and type from the data.

KIT AND METHOD FOR MEASURING A PIPE COUPLING GROOVE
A pipe groove gauge kit for measuring the width, depth and location of a coupling groove adjacent an end of a pipe includes a plurality of pipe groove gauges. Each pipe groove gauge includes a rigid, planar member extending in a longitudinal direction. The planar member has a leg disposed at a first end and a tab disposed between the first and second ends. The leg has an inner edge adapted to be held against an end of an associated length of pipe and the tab is adapted to be inserted into a coupling groove of the associated length of pipe. The tab height corresponds to a specified depth of a coupling groove for a particular pipe configuration and the tab width corresponds to a specified width of the coupling groove for the particular pipe configuration.

Quality control system for analyzing the quality of a battery cell through a volumetric measurement of gas formed during a cell formation process and a method of analyzing the same
A quality control system analyzes the quality of a battery cell, with the battery cell defining a gas pouch configured to expand from a deflated configuration to an inflated configuration when filled with a gas formed during a cell formation process. The system comprises a computational system comprising a processor and a memory and a measurement instrument in electronic communication with the computational system. The measurement instrument is arranged to measure a distance defined by the gas pouch and transmit a signal to the computational system corresponding to the distance. The computational system is arranged to analyze the distance with the processor and determine a volumetric measurement of the gas within the gas pouch and compare the volumetric measurement to a threshold in the memory to assess a quality score for the battery cell. A corresponding method analyzes the quality of the battery cell with the quality control system.
